If you want the most fantastic vegetarian ravioli, try the pumpkin ravioli at WGP Cafe, in DTD. It is served in brown butter sauce, with fried sage, port wine glaze, toasted pine nuts and aged parmesan. When served with a decent glass of wine, I am in heaven when I order this! For dessert try the chocolate fondue and share it with a loved one It is served with homemade marshmallows, brownies, cinnamon cake and fresh strawberries.
I also have had great butternut squash ravioli at the CG. Their menu changes quite frequently, and according to allearsnet.com, it's not currently on their menu. They are serving tortelloni with buffalo mozzarella, ramps, chanterelles, sweet peas, and truffle oil, and that sounds like a pretty good substitute for a vegetarian ravioli!
